Exploring the Variety of Indian Dishes Available


One of the key attractions of Indian food in bangkok is its extensive variety of dishes. Indian cuisine is famous for its regional variety, which is reflected in the extensive menus offered by Bangkok restaurants.

North Indian cuisine remains highly popular, offering dishes like butter chicken, paneer tikka, and tandoor-baked naan. These dishes are flavourful and often accompanied by creamy gravies that provide a comforting taste.

South Indian cuisine is rising in demand, with dosa, idli, and sambar attracting health-conscious individuals. These dishes are lighter, often vegetarian, and provide a distinct flavour compared to North Indian cuisine.

In addition to Indian food in bangkok main courses, Indian restaurants also serve a variety of appetisers, desserts, and beverages. From savoury samosas to sweet gulab jamun and cooling lassi, every item enhances the overall culinary experience.

Vegetarian and Vegan Options in Indian Cuisine


One more factor behind the popularity of Indian food in bangkok is its broad selection of vegetarian and vegan dishes. Indian cuisine has a long tradition of plant-based cooking, making it ideal for those who prefer meat-free meals.

Many Indian restaurants provide specialised vegetarian menus featuring lentils, vegetables, paneer, and legumes. Common choices include dal, vegetable curry, and chana masala. Vegan customers can also enjoy many options, as several dishes can be made without dairy.

This inclusiveness allows everyone to enjoy a fulfilling meal, regardless of dietary needs. It also helps increase the appeal of Indian restaurants among a broad audience.
